Top 5 In-Demand Data Engineer Careers in the USA

Discover the top 5 data engineer careers in the USA, exploring roles that are in high demand and offer great opportunities for growth.

In an era dominated by data, the role of data engineers has become increasingly vital. As companies strive to harness the power of data analytics, the demand for skilled data engineers has surged. This article delves into the top careers in data engineering within the USA, emphasizing the skills required, potential career paths, and the future of this exciting field.

The Importance of Data Engineering

Data engineering serves as the backbone of data science initiatives. While data scientists analyze data, data engineers are responsible for designing, constructing, and maintaining the systems that allow data to be collected, stored, and processed efficiently. Here are some key responsibilities of data engineers:

  • Building data pipelines and architectures.
  • Ensuring data quality and integrity.
  • Implementing data storage solutions that facilitate easy access and analysis.
  • Collaborating with data scientists to understand data needs.

1. Data Engineer

The foundational role in this field, data engineers focus on developing, constructing, and maintaining data infrastructures. They work with large datasets, optimizing data flows and ensuring that data is accessible and usable for analytical purposes.

Key Skills Required:

  • Proficiency in programming languages like Python, Java, or Scala.
  • Experience with SQL and NoSQL databases.
  • Familiarity with data warehousing solutions such as Amazon Redshift or Google BigQuery.
  • Understanding of ETL (Extract, Transform, Load) processes.

Potential Career Path:

  1. Junior Data Engineer
  2. Data Engineer
  3. Senior Data Engineer
  4. Lead Data Engineer
  5. Data Architect

2. Big Data Engineer

With the explosion of big data technologies, big data engineers have emerged as a specialized branch of data engineering. These professionals focus on managing and processing vast volumes of data using distributed computing systems.

Key Skills Required:

  • Expertise in big data technologies like Hadoop, Spark, and Kafka.
  • Ability to work with distributed databases such as HBase or Cassandra.
  • Strong understanding of data modeling and data warehousing concepts.
  • Proficiency in cloud computing platforms such as AWS or Azure.

Potential Career Path:

  1. Big Data Analyst
  2. Big Data Engineer
  3. Senior Big Data Engineer
  4. Big Data Solutions Architect

3. Data Warehouse Engineer

Data Warehouse Engineers specialize in designing and managing data warehouses, which are central repositories that store integrated data from multiple sources. They ensure that data is structured for analysis and reporting.

Key Skills Required:

  • Expertise in data warehousing solutions like Snowflake, Teradata, or Oracle.
  • Proficient in data modeling and database design.
  • Familiarity with OLAP (Online Analytical Processing) tools.
  • Strong SQL skills for querying data.

Potential Career Path:

  1. Data Analyst
  2. Data Warehouse Developer
  3. Data Warehouse Engineer
  4. Data Warehouse Architect

4. Machine Learning Engineer

Though slightly different from traditional data engineering roles, machine learning engineers play a crucial part in the data lifecycle by creating algorithms that enable machines to learn from and make predictions based on data.

Key Skills Required:

  • Strong programming skills in Python or R.
  • Deep understanding of machine learning frameworks such as TensorFlow or PyTorch.
  • Experience in data preprocessing and feature engineering.
  • Familiarity with data pipeline tools to integrate machine learning models.

Potential Career Path:

  1. Data Scientist
  2. Machine Learning Engineer
  3. Senior Machine Learning Engineer
  4. Machine Learning Manager

5. DataOps Engineer

DataOps Engineers focus on enhancing the speed and quality of data analytics through DevOps principles applied to data management. They ensure that data is delivered quickly and accurately to stakeholders.

Key Skills Required:

  • Experience in CI/CD pipelines for data workflows.
  • Familiarity with data versioning and lineage tracking tools.
  • Knowledge of containerization technologies like Docker and Kubernetes.
  • Proficiency in monitoring and observability tools for data systems.

Potential Career Path:

  1. Data Engineer
  2. DataOps Engineer
  3. Senior DataOps Engineer
  4. Director of DataOps

Future Trends in Data Engineering

As technology evolves, so does the landscape of data engineering. Here are some emerging trends that are shaping the future of this field:

Trend Description
Increased Automation Automation is set to streamline data pipeline processes, facilitating faster data collection and processing.
Real-Time Data Processing With the rise of IoT and streaming data, real-time data processing will become a standard requirement.
Serverless Architectures Serverless computing offers scalability and cost-effectiveness, allowing data engineers to focus on building rather than managing servers.
Data Privacy and Compliance As data regulations become stricter, data engineers will need to implement robust data governance frameworks.

Conclusion

Data engineering is a dynamic and rapidly evolving field that offers numerous career opportunities. By equipping yourself with the necessary skills and staying abreast of industry trends, you can thrive in one of the top data engineer careers in the USA. Whether you aspire to be a Big Data Engineer or venture into DataOps, the possibilities are vast, and the future is bright.

FAQ

What is the role of a Data Engineer?

A Data Engineer is responsible for designing, building, and maintaining the infrastructure that allows for the collection, storage, and analysis of data.

What skills are essential for a Data Engineer?

Essential skills for a Data Engineer include programming languages such as Python and Java, knowledge of SQL and NoSQL databases, data warehousing solutions, and experience with big data technologies like Hadoop and Spark.

What are the top industries hiring Data Engineers in the USA?

Top industries hiring Data Engineers include technology, finance, healthcare, e-commerce, and telecommunications.

What is the average salary of a Data Engineer in the USA?

As of 2023, the average salary of a Data Engineer in the USA ranges from $90,000 to $150,000, depending on experience and location.

What educational background is preferred for a Data Engineer?

A bachelor’s degree in computer science, information technology, or a related field is commonly preferred for Data Engineer positions, with many also holding advanced degrees.